Novartis to Help Make CureVac Covid-19 Vaccine
The Swiss drug company will make mRNA and other parts of
CureVac's two-dose vaccine, which is in late-stage testing with
results expected as soon as next month.

GM Looking to Build Second Battery Factory in U.S.
General Motors and joint-venture partner LG Chem are close to
completing a decision to locate the plant in Tennessee, said people
familiar with the matter.
Roundup Plaintiffs' Lawyers Spar Over $800 Million in Fees
The firms that led the litigation against Bayer argue that they
deserve a bigger slice of the nearly $10 billion settlement than
those that joined later.

Jeep-Owner Stellantis Is Open to Dropping Cherokee Name
CEO Carlos Tavares said the auto company is holding talks with
the Cherokee Nation over use of the Native American tribe's name in
Jeep's line of vehicles.
Lufthansa Expects Demand to Rise But Cash Drain Continues
Lufthansa said it doesn't expect capacity to rise beyond 50% of
2019's levels this year and expected continued cash outflow of
around EUR300 a month in the first quarter, after the airline
reported an adjusted annual loss of EUR5.45 billion.
